Lower-income footing on only 1 ZIP ($42,470 average) · poverty 27.4%. The primary code (65791) carries the ACS household fields that matter.

Owner-occupancy sits in a mixed band (73.2%) - check the ZIP page's tenure split before treating Thayer as a pure owner town.

Within Missouri, Annapolis is the closest lower-income city and Tecumseh the closest higher-income city by average ZIP household income. Their 1 and 1 ZIP footprints are the immediate statewide comparison set for Thayer.

Census ZBP business roll-up

Mid-pack ZBP load on Thayer's one ZIP

Citywide ZBP: 102 establishments, 862 employees , annual payroll $28,395k (~22 establishments per 1,000 residents) across 1 of 1 ZIPs. Peak business ZIP 65791 (102 units) ; leading NAICS Retail trade (32) · also Health care and social assistance · Other services (except public administration) .
